The Benefits of Move for Hunger

Move for Hunger started small back in 2009. The organization was originally worried about getting members due to limited time and resources. However, participating movers say that the benefits are undeniable. Now, there are over 350 AMSA moving companies in 42 different states working together to deliver food to food banks. Over 519,000 meals have been provided to food banks nationwide thanks to the extreme growth of Move for Hunger.

AMSA Attracts Attendance at Conference

Last October, AMSA’s annual Safety and Operations Conference was held in San Antonio, Texas. The conference had nearly 70 participants, breaking attendance records. Coincidentally, it was held in the same hotel as the Claims Prevention and Procedures Council, allowing both groups to network with each other. However, the Safety and Operations Conference was designed to provide practice solutions to every day problems in the moving industry, along with providing the latest and greatest news and innovations in the industry.
